- Loadout abstract "Loadout is a free-to-play third person shooter developed by Austin-based studio, Edge of Reality. Currently only available to download on Steam, Loadout focuses on arcade-style multi-player firefights across a variety of modes. The game is notable for its over-the-top cartoon gore and wealth of character customization options. Players can alter the appearance of their in-game avatar as well as the properties of their weapons.".
